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PULL 6/6] migration_init: Fix lock initialisation/make it explicit

Peter reported a lock error on MacOS after my a82d593b
patch.

migrate_get_current does one-time initialisation of
a bunch of variables.
migrate_init does reinitialisation even on a 2nd
migrate after a cancel.

The problem here was that I'd initialised the mutex
in migrate_get_current, and the memset in migrate_init
corrupted it.

Remove the memset and replace it by explicit initialisation
of fields that need initialising; this also turns out to be simpler
than the old code that had to preserve some fields.

---
 migration/migration.c | 51 ++++++++++++++++++++++-----------------------------
 1 file changed, 22 insertions(+), 29 deletions(-)

diff --git a/migration/migration.c b/migration/migration.c
index 9bd2ce7..7e4e27b 100644
--- a/migration/migration.c
+++ b/migration/migration.c
@@ -902,38 +902,31 @@ bool migration_in_postcopy(MigrationState *s)
 MigrationState *migrate_init(const MigrationParams *params)
 {
     MigrationState *s = migrate_get_current();
-    int64_t bandwidth_limit = s->bandwidth_limit;
-    bool enabled_capabilities[MIGRATION_CAPABILITY_MAX];
-    int64_t xbzrle_cache_size = s->xbzrle_cache_size;
-    int compress_level = s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_COMPRESS_LEVEL];
-    int compress_thread_count =
-            s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_COMPRESS_THREADS];
-    int decompress_thread_count =
-            s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_DECOMPRESS_THREADS];
-    int x_cpu_throttle_initial =
-            s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_X_CPU_THROTTLE_INITIAL];
-    int x_cpu_throttle_increment =
-            s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_X_CPU_THROTTLE_INCREMENT];

-    memcpy(enabled_capabilities, s->enabled_capabilities,
-           sizeof(enabled_capabilities));
-
-    memset(s, 0, sizeof(*s));
+    /*
+     * Reinitialise all migration state, except
+     * parameters/capabilities that the user set, and
+     * locks.
+     */
+    s->bytes_xfer = 0;
+    s->xfer_limit = 0;
+    s->cleanup_bh = 0;
+    s->file = NULL;
+    s->state = MIGRATION_STATUS_NONE;
     s->params = *params;
-    memcpy(s->enabled_capabilities, enabled_capabilities,
-           sizeof(enabled_capabilities));
-    s->xbzrle_cache_size = xbzrle_cache_size;
+    s->rp_state.from_dst_file = NULL;
+    s->rp_state.error = false;
+    s->mbps = 0.0;
+    s->downtime = 0;
+    s->expected_downtime = 0;
+    s->dirty_pages_rate = 0;
+    s->dirty_bytes_rate = 0;
+    s->setup_time = 0;
+    s->dirty_sync_count = 0;
+    s->start_postcopy = false;
+    s->migration_thread_running = false;
+    s->last_req_rb = NULL;

-    s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_COMPRESS_LEVEL] = compress_level;
-    s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_COMPRESS_THREADS] =
-               compress_thread_count;
-    s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_DECOMPRESS_THREADS] =
-               decompress_thread_count;
-    s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_X_CPU_THROTTLE_INITIAL] =
-                x_cpu_throttle_initial;
-    s->parameters[MIGRATION_PARAMETER_X_CPU_THROTTLE_INCREMENT] =
-                x_cpu_throttle_increment;
-    s->bandwidth_limit = bandwidth_limit;
     migrate_set_state(s, MIGRATION_STATUS_NONE, MIGRATION_STATUS_SETUP);

     QSIMPLEQ_INIT(&s->src_page_requests);
